10 students killed in Nigeria school building collapse


Abuja, Sep 14 (IANS): At least 10 students died and 21 others were injured when the school building they were in collapsed in Nigeria's Jos city, authorities said on Monday.

Mohammed Abdulsalam, a spokesman of the National Emergency Management Agency, said the incident occurred on Sunday during full session at the local school in which about 38 pupils were in attendance, Xinhua news agency reported.

The official said seven pupils died on the spot while three others succumbed to their injuries on Monday while undergoing treatment in hospital.

Authorities in the school said about 50 pupils were usually in attendance during the daily Arabic classes but heavy downpour on Sunday might have prevented other school children from coming.
